Guaviña Church(Reads: 855, 17-Mar-2011)This is a National Monument which dates back to the 18th century. It is found in the town of Guaviña and like other churches in the area, it reflects the Baroque style. It has a stone doorway, engraved and in the shape of an arch. It used to be supported by the San Nicolás de Tolentino Church.
